Hi there, hope someone can help.

I was driving my CLK the other day, did about 15 miles then stopped to pick up some friends. Car wouldn't start when I tried after only about 10 minutes with engine off.

I looked in the boot and noticed that a clear plastic lead extending from the side of the battery was completely off. I had just had my spare tyre replaced and assume they knocked the lead off when putting it back. I stuck it back in the hole and the car started, but I got all sorts of warnings about low battery charge.

This morning the car failed to start again and needed jumped, which worked first time. I took it for a run, so we'll see it it has charged up.

My question is: what is this tube / lead for? I can't find into about it anywhere and can only assume its for topping up battery fluid from some remote reservoir?

I'm wondering if it being disconnected has done any damage and I'm also wondering if I'm right in my guess about what it is - never seen anything like it on a battery before.

Appeciate any input.

The tube you refer to is more than likely just a vent tube .Perhaps the terminals should be checked they may be loose .
